原创Canvas从入门到实战教程。持续更新。
本教程配套示例仓库:https://github.com/wanglin2/canvas-demos。
- 开始
- 基本使用
- 实战:实现一个橡皮擦
- 路径
- 实战:绘制一个圆角矩形
- 实战:绘制一个箭头
- 实战:实现一个电子签名
- 图象
- 实战:将DOM节点转换为图片
- 实战:压缩图片
- 实战:实现商品图片放大镜效果
- 文本
- 实战:实现一个排版引擎
- 变换
- 实战:绘制一个正多边形
- 事件
- 实战:实现一个贝塞尔曲线编辑器
- 像素
- 实战:图片滤镜
- 实战:实现粒子文字效果
- 动画
- 实战:绘制一个水波图
- 实战:实现一个探照灯
- 实战:放一个烟花
- 性能
- 类库
本地启动:docsify serve ./ --port 3001